What is OpenAI?
At its core, OpenAI is an artificial intelligence research and deployment company. But it’s more than just a company; it’s a mission-driven organization focused on ensuring that artificial general intelligence (AGI) benefits all of humanity. Founded in late 2015, OpenAI set out with the ambitious goal of creating safe and beneficial AI. Unlike traditional tech companies primarily driven by profit, OpenAI was initially established as a non-profit research company. This unique structure allowed it to prioritize research and development in AI safety and ethics, rather than being solely focused on commercial applications. The founders, including prominent figures like Elon Musk and Sam Altman, envisioned an AI future where technology serves as a powerful tool for solving some of the world's most pressing challenges, from climate change to healthcare. This vision required a commitment to open collaboration, attracting some of the brightest minds in the field to work together on advancing the state of AI. Over the years, OpenAI has evolved, transitioning to a capped-profit model to attract investment while still maintaining its core mission. This hybrid approach has enabled the company to balance its research goals with the need for resources to support large-scale projects and infrastructure. The transition also reflected a growing understanding of the complexities involved in building and deploying advanced AI systems, necessitating a more sustainable financial model. Today, OpenAI continues to push the boundaries of what's possible with AI, developing cutting-edge technologies and exploring the ethical implications of its work.
Key People Behind OpenAI
The success of any tech company hinges on its leadership and the talent of its team. OpenAI is no exception. Several key figures have been instrumental in shaping the direction and achievements of the company. Sam Altman, the CEO of OpenAI, has been a driving force in the company's strategic vision. With a background in startups and venture capital, Altman brings a unique blend of business acumen and technological insight to OpenAI. Under his leadership, the company has navigated the complex landscape of AI development, forging partnerships, and launching groundbreaking products. Prior to leading OpenAI, Altman was the president of Y Combinator, a renowned startup accelerator, giving him a deep understanding of the challenges and opportunities in the tech world. Greg Brockman, the Chairman and CTO, is another pivotal figure. Brockman's technical expertise and deep understanding of AI have been critical in guiding OpenAI's research efforts. His background in mathematics and computer science, combined with his experience at Stripe, laid the foundation for his contributions to OpenAI. Brockman's focus on building robust and scalable AI infrastructure has been essential for supporting the company's ambitious projects. Ilya Sutskever, the Chief Scientist, is one of the world's leading experts in deep learning. Sutskever's research has been fundamental to many of OpenAI's breakthroughs, including the development of advanced neural networks. His expertise in training large language models and his commitment to AI safety have made him an invaluable asset to the company. Before joining OpenAI, Sutskever worked with Geoffrey Hinton, a pioneer in the field of neural networks, at the University of Toronto. OpenAI's Notable Projects and Technologies
OpenAI has been behind some truly game-changing projects! Let’s explore some of their most impressive creations and technologies. GPT models are at the forefront of OpenAI's innovations. The Generative Pre-trained Transformer (GPT) series has revolutionized natural language processing. Models like GPT-3 and GPT-4 are capable of generating human-quality text, translating languages, writing different kinds of creative content, and answering your questions in an informative way. These models have been used in a wide range of applications, from content creation and customer service to education and research. The GPT models are trained on massive amounts of text data, allowing them to learn patterns and relationships in language. This enables them to generate coherent and contextually relevant text for a variety of tasks. DALL-E is another standout project from OpenAI. DALL-E is an AI model that can create images from textual descriptions. Users can input a text prompt, and DALL-E will generate corresponding images, often with surprising and creative results. This technology has opened up new possibilities for art, design, and visual communication. DALL-E combines natural language processing with image generation, allowing users to explore the intersection of language and visual representation. OpenAI also has made significant strides in robotics. OpenAI has been exploring how AI can be used to control robots. OpenAI's robotics research focuses on training robots to perform complex tasks through reinforcement learning. This involves creating simulated environments where robots can learn to interact with objects and navigate their surroundings. OpenAI's robotics projects aim to develop robots that can assist humans in a variety of settings, from manufacturing and logistics to healthcare and disaster response. These projects are pushing the boundaries of what's possible with AI-powered robots. OpenAI's Codex model translates natural language into code, making it easier for people to write software. Codex has been used to power GitHub Copilot, an AI pair programmer that assists developers in writing code. This technology has the potential to revolutionize software development, making it more accessible and efficient. Codex is trained on a large dataset of code, allowing it to understand the syntax and semantics of different programming languages. This enables it to generate code snippets, suggest code completions, and even write entire functions based on natural language descriptions.
